First I will start by saying, I am a newbie. Recently purchased a ´56 HT, which has a 390" from a ´63 in it. I have decided to put a new Holley on it, but not 100% sure which one would be the best choice.I am leaning towards a 600CFM Brawler w. vacuum secondary. Am I completely off or?And would I need a adaptor plate between carburator and manifold? Does anyone know which one?Regards Henrik Sonne(Denmark)See More
